About
Claves Records is a Swiss classical music record label founded in 1968 in Thun. Dedicated to every kind of classical music, Claves likes to give priority to young artists, rare repertoires, Swiss interpreters and composers, works previously unreleased on CD, and historical rereleases. The catalog includes almost 600 recordings. (From the label)
